Rapid heartbeat.....
Last Friday night , my husband and I had just gotten home and went out to sit on the deck. While I was sitting there, all of a sudden, my heart started pounding something terrible. So, I went inside and laid down on the couch. It was going so fast, I couldn't even count that fast.... so Dale called the neighbor , who is an EMT, asked him about it, and he thought I should go to the ER.....Wouldn't you know , I have one last payment from the hospital last time to pay this month....anyhow, when I got to the ER, my heart rate was 200. They got me hooked up to monitors, and did an EKG, xray,etc...Well, my heart rate went up to 215 , and was between 200-215 for over an hour.... I was really getting scared. They had me do Vagals, (pushing like having a baby) to try to reset my heartbeat..This didn't work, so they had to give me some medicine thru my IV... Oh, my word, did it hurt....It burnt when it went in, and slowly but surely, my rate started coming down. It took a while, but I finally started to feel better. All blood work came back good, all tests, good. They have put me on some medicine to keep my heart rate more even. I have an appt. at my drs tomorrow..
